The Region : Light-Rail Line Study OKd

Share

County transportation planners are launching a $300,000 study on the feasibility of installing a light-rail line to parallel the transit corridor outlined by San Bernardino and Pomona freeways.

“This will be an important step toward bringing rail transit to a major portion of eastern Los Angeles County,” Supervisor Deane Dana said of the study, as he announced that three supervisorial districts will provide $25,000 to help pay for it.

Eight cities involved in the project--Whittier, Alhambra, Commerce, El Monte, South El Monte, Los Angeles, Montebello and San Gabriel--will supply $75,000.

Most of the funds will come from the Los Angeles Transportation Commission.
